For the fitness enthusiasts, you will be thrilled to know that the community programmes have returned after a short hiatus, with an array of new offerings! From Cardio Dance to SuperFit Power Intense and Cardio Blast, get your heart pumping with Garmin’s exhilarating dance and high-intensity training sports sessions.
Alternatively, wind down after a long day of work-from-home and get in touch with your inner self with SuperFit Power Yoga and Keep Fit Taiji Wellness, or get in touch with nature with SuperTrail. There is an activity for everyone, regardless of age groups and fitness levels.
Note: Programme registration (compulsory) can be done through the ELXR® App available at the App Store or Google Play.
